Transaction 61320f5aa426817742f0549f78b13d6caf1a55bcb81fe580fdcef9a4b16422b3
1 Input
1 Output
-
61320f5aa426817742f0549f78b13d6caf1a55bcb81fe580fdcef9a4b16422b3:0
- value
- 2063547
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 8caff525c9a533ba9aa68371b0b2548503fd4521 OP_EQUAL
- address
- 3EWuK9bH81TsgmEVszPYLTuYG2LRBXxH5b